文件名称:logdna-cos:Node.js函数,用于将所有日志文件从云对象存储发送到LogDNA
文件大小:1.02MB
文件格式:ZIP
更新时间:2024-05-20 14:40:27
nodejs cis serverless cos ibm-cloud
将日志从Cloud Internet Services导入LogDNA IBM Cloud:trade_mark:企业计划Internet服务提供了Logpush功能,该功能每100,000个日志或每30秒(以先到者为准)将至少一个日志包(在.gz文件上)发送到上的桶。 每30秒或每100,000个日志可能会推送多个文件。 对于这些日志,有一项名为的服务,该服务可以接收所有日志并将其显示在一个平台上(您可以从Kubernetes集群,VM等发送日志)。 要将所有日志导入LogDNA,您需要在IBM Cloud Functions上设置无服务器功能,该功能使用触发器自动调用您的功能。 触发器侦听IBM Cloud Object Storage上的写事件。 每当CIS将对象上传到IBM Cloud Object Storage存储桶时,触发器就会调用您的函数,该函数处理日志包并将其自动发送到LogDNA实例。
【文件预览】:
logdna-cos-master
----.eslintrc.json(332B)
----.prettierignore(35B)
----.prettierrc.json(3B)
----doc()
--------source()
----CONTRIBUTING.md(798B)
----LICENSE(11KB)
----README.md(10KB)
----manifest.yml(1KB)
----handler.js(5KB)
----CODE_OF_CONDUCT.md(5KB)
----.gitignore(2KB)
----package-lock.json(93KB)
----package.json(820B)